Game Title: Cyberquizz

Playable link: https://play.google.com/store/apps/details?id=com.ldpixel.cyberquiz

Platform: Android

Description: Cyberquizz is a quiz game with a slightly electronic vibe. You can play it online or offline. There's a friends system if you want to add friends and challenge them to a duel. You will find there a general ranking and a PVP ranking. There is a mission system, as well as titles to be earned.

The game contains several categories, ranging from history and video games to mythology. There's even an easy mode for children. Every categorie can be unlocked for free.

Free-to-Play status: free to play

Involvement: I developed this game entirely on my own, except for the logo and music. It took me several months. This is the first game I've created; it was a great experience, and I hope you enjoy it.

I used to love the style of quick competitive quiz games like QuizUp, and I feel like there hasn’t been a really good modern replacement for that experience.

So I’m building a mobile game called Quiz Hero.

The idea is simple: you play quizzes across lots of categories, but you also choose, customise, name and level up your own superhero. Each hero has a unique power that can help during a quiz.

For example:

Speedster gives you extra time to answer.

Brainiac removes one wrong answer.

There will be friend challenges, ranked play, leaderboards, hero progression, customisation, and superhero groups called Legions.
